With guests Thomas Rhett and Eric Collins

Award-winning country music star Thomas Rhett discusses his album Country Again: Side A, and investor and entrepreneur Eric Collins talks about the Channel 4 series The Money Maker. Plus there's more Factoids, the Non-Stop Oldies and the latest entertainment and lifestyle news.
